Because the patch stabilized the core script engine and expanded the hardcoded limits for units and map regions, it allowed modders to create masterpieces. Without version 1.5, iconic mods like (Lord of the Rings), Stainless Steel (historical realism), and Divide and Conquer would simply not function. The patch effectively handed the keys of the game engine over to the community, ensuring decades of replayability. 4. How to Update and Verify Your Version Today
